Care Home Director Jailed for Hiring Illegal Workers in East Sussex

A care home recruitment director in south-east England has been jailed for hiring Indian immigrants with no right to work in the UK. Benoy Thomas, 50, ran A Class Care Recruitment Ltd in Bexhill-on-Sea. He hired 13 illegal workers between 2017 and 2018.

Lewes Crown Court convicted him in July after a detailed trial. The court heard that he used contacts in southern India to bring workers into the UK. He then placed them in care roles without proper checks or training.

Prosecutors said these workers handled vulnerable people and lacked medical skills. Investigators also discovered that Thomas tried to hide documents in a garage before his arrest.

The Crown Prosecution Service presented timesheets, invoices, messages, bank records and handwritten notes. The evidence showed that he knowingly arranged work for people without legal status.

Thomas arrived in the UK in 2007 and became a British citizen in 2012. He will serve two-and-a-half years in prison. The court also banned him from serving as a company director for eight years. The CPS said it will continue to act against those who exploit immigration rules.
